Scott F.
Large held former positions as Associate Deputy Director-Science & Technology at the Central Intelligence Agency (United States), Director-Source Operations at the United States National Geospatial-Intelligence Agency, Senior Vice President-Intelligence & Space Sector at SRA International, Inc., and was a member of the Intelligence Committee at AFCEA International.
He received his undergraduate degree from the University of Central Florida in 1979.
